linux-mod-r1.eclass: drop list of sign algorithms in eclassdocs

Kernel 7.x is due to drop support for sha1 signing and, rather than
just cleanup that one, may as well remove the entire list so we will
not need to maintain it. Albeit still keep one example just to give
the idea of what is recognized.

(skipping dev ML for a basic docs-only change)
